Description of problem: dnf seems to replace $releasever/$basearch in mirrorlist url, but not in the mirror url, which is needed for kde-redhat.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): dnf-0.3.4-1.git03fd687.fc19.noarch Steps to Reproduce: 1. add http://apt.kde-redhat.org/apt/kde-redhat/fedora/kde.repo in /etc/yum.repos.d 2. dnf update Actual results: Problem with repo 'kde': Error HTTP/FTP status code: 404, disabling. Expected results: repo metadata downloaded Additional info: http://apt.kde-redhat.org/apt/kde-redhat/fedora/mirrors-stable contains http://mirror.unl.edu/kde-redhat/fedora/$releasever/$basearch/stable, which is used directly without replacing $releasever/$basearch, so the servers sends a 404.
Fixed by 10cb4c2.
